The Connection Between NLP and NXIVM
NXIVM, founded by Keith Raniere, claimed to offer programs that utilized NLP principles. However, the organization faced multiple allegations, including human trafficking, racketeering, and sexual misconduct. It is crucial to understand that the actions of NXIVM do not represent the entire field of NLP. It is an extreme case that highlights the potential dangers of misusing psychology for personal gain and manipulation.

What is NXIVM?
NXIVM was a company and self-help organization founded in 1998. It claimed to offer personal and professional development programs but later became embroiled in various legal controversies.
How were NLP and NXIVM connected?
NXIVM incorporated some teachings and techniques from NLP into their programs. However, their actions and practices went beyond the principles of NLP, leading to legal issues.
What were some of the controversies surrounding NXIVM?
NXIVM faced various controversies, including allegations of cult-like behavior, sexual abuse, and human trafficking. Its founder, Keith Raniere, was convicted of numerous charges in 2019.
